Output 21a40f969b0b0c401cedd95a8273264a155a5c50fe69d0797d282cb6400093c9:4

value
22531208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7ee4885de819679513a43720f009f0385c6708e OP_EQUAL
address
3Kv9qvybMvJnHi33bQGUKPtd9MpLgL6GWG
transaction
21a40f969b0b0c401cedd95a8273264a155a5c50fe69d0797d282cb6400093c9
confirmations
268212
spent
true